PATHFINDER-CHD: prospective registry on adults with congenital heart disease, abnormal ventricular function, and/or heart failure as a foundation for establishing rehabilitative, prehabilitative, preventive, and health-promoting measures: rationale, aims, design and methods.

Sebastian FreilingerHarald KaemmererRobert D PittrowStefan AchenbachStefan BaldusOliver DewaldPeter EwertAnnika FreibergerMatthias GorenfloFrank HarigChristopher HohmannStefan HoldenriederJürgen HörerMichael HuntgeburthMichael HüblerNiko KohlsFrank KlawonnRainer Kozlik-FeldmannRenate KaulitzDirk LoßnitzerFriedrich MellertNicole NagdymanJohannes NordmeyerBenjamin A PittrowLeonard B PittrowCarsten RickersStefan RosenkranzJörg SchellingChristoph SinningMathieu N SuleimanYskert von KodolitschFabian von ScheidtAnn-Sophie Kaemmerer-Suleiman
Published in: BMC cardiovascular disorders (2024)
The PATHFINDER-CHD Registry is poised to offer valuable insights into HF management in ACHD, bridging current knowledge gaps, enhancing patient care, and shaping future research endeavors in this domain.
